Elaborative interrogation means asking "why?" as you revise, linking new facts to things you already know. Re-reading means going back over notes or a textbook passively. The EEF rates interrogation positively; re-reading is among the least effective revision strategies in the research for building durable memory.

What is elaborative interrogation?

Elaborative interrogation is a revision technique built on one repeated question: Why is this true?

Instead of reading that "plants absorb water through osmosis", you ask: Why do plants absorb water through osmosis? What is the concentration gradient that drives it? Why does that gradient exist in root hair cells? Answering those questions requires you to connect the fact to your existing knowledge of cell membranes, solute concentrations, and biological transport — creating a web of understanding rather than an isolated fact.

The technique was developed in educational psychology research as a way to move information from surface recall to genuine comprehension. The more connections a piece of knowledge has to other things you know, the more routes the brain has to retrieve it under exam pressure.

Worked example — GCSE Biology (osmosis):

What re-reading gives you What elaborative interrogation adds
"Water moves from high water potential to low water potential" Why? — because molecules diffuse down concentration gradients
"Root hair cells absorb water by osmosis" Why do they have a lower water potential? — because of dissolved mineral ions taken up by active transport
"Water moves up the plant through the xylem" Why doesn't it just diffuse back out through osmosis? — because of cohesion-tension and the apoplast pathway

Each "why?" question demands that you explain the mechanism, not just repeat the label. This is precisely the kind of understanding that GCSE mark schemes reward in six-mark extended answer questions.

What is re-reading?

Re-reading is the most common revision technique reported by secondary school students in the UK. It involves sitting with a textbook, revision guide, or set of notes and reading them again — sometimes highlighting, sometimes not.

Re-reading feels productive because it is comfortable and familiar. The information looks known; the reading goes quickly; the student finishes feeling like they have revised. The problem is that this feeling of recognition ("I've seen this before") is not the same as recallability ("I can produce this from memory under exam conditions"). Research in cognitive psychology consistently shows that re-reading produces weak long-term retention compared with strategies that require active retrieval or generation.

The EEF's Teaching and Learning Toolkit, which reviews evidence from large-scale studies, describes re-reading as a low-impact strategy compared with retrieval practice, elaborative interrogation, and spaced practice.

How do the two strategies compare?

Factor Elaborative interrogation Re-reading
EEF evidence rating Positive (moderate evidence) Low impact
Memory depth Deep (connects to prior knowledge) Shallow (surface recognition)
Retention after 1 week High — connections reinforce memory Low — recognition fades quickly
Effort required High — requires thinking Low — passive
Suitable for all subjects? Yes — ask "why" in every subject Yes — but rarely effective alone
Best for Understanding processes, causes, relationships Initial familiarisation with new content
Time efficiency Slower per page but better outcomes Fast per page but poor outcomes
Works with flashcards? Can be combined (add "why?" to the answer side) Not naturally combined

How do you use elaborative interrogation in practice?

The technique works in three stages:

Stage 1 — Read a fact or statement from your notes or textbook. Don't highlight it. Understand what it says.

Stage 2 — Ask why or how. Write down one or more questions:

  • Why is this true?
  • How does this connect to [something I already know]?
  • What would happen if this were NOT true?
  • What caused this? What does this cause?

Stage 3 — Answer the question without looking back at the notes. If you can't answer it, re-read the relevant section and try again. Then close the book and explain the answer in your own words.

Applied to GCSE History example (causes of the First World War):

  • Fact: "The assassination of Archduke Franz Ferdinand triggered the July Crisis."
  • Why: Why did this one event trigger a war involving almost all of Europe?
  • Connection: Because of the alliance system (Triple Entente, Triple Alliance) — why did those alliances exist? Because of imperial rivalry, nationalism, and the arms race — why had those developed over the preceding decades?

Following the chain of "why?" questions builds a causal web that exam questions explicitly reward. Mark schemes for "explain why" or "how far was [factor] responsible?" questions allocate marks to students who can trace cause-and-effect chains — which is exactly what elaborative interrogation trains.

Frequently asked questions

Can I combine elaborative interrogation with re-reading?

Yes, and doing so is better than using either alone. A practical approach: re-read a section quickly to gain initial familiarity, then close the book and apply elaborative interrogation questions to what you just read. The re-reading provides the raw material; the interrogation builds the connections. This is more effective than re-reading the same section multiple times without the questioning step.

Does elaborative interrogation work for mathematics?

In maths, the equivalent technique is asking "why does this method work?" rather than just practising the procedure. A student who knows only that "to find the gradient, divide the change in y by the change in x" is more fragile under exam pressure than one who understands that gradient measures steepness as a rate of change and can apply this to novel graph situations. Asking "why does this formula work?" and sketching the geometry behind it is elaborative interrogation applied to maths.

How long should an elaborative interrogation session last?

Fifteen to twenty-five minutes per topic is a realistic and effective session length. Elaborative interrogation is cognitively demanding — more so than re-reading — and fatigue sets in faster. Three focused twenty-minute sessions on different topics in an evening are more effective than two hours of passive re-reading. Pairing the technique with spaced repetition (returning to the same topic's questions a few days later) produces the strongest long-term retention.

Is elaborative interrogation the same as the Feynman technique?

They overlap but are not identical. The Feynman technique specifically involves trying to explain a concept as if to a child, identifying gaps in the explanation, and going back to learn what is missing. Elaborative interrogation is more targeted — it asks "why?" about specific facts to build connections. Both require active generation rather than passive reception. Students who find Feynman difficult to apply to facts (rather than concepts) often find elaborative interrogation more practical for data-heavy GCSE subjects like Biology or History.
